About Asher

Asher is around 15 months old and tips the scales at about 75 lbs. While his age categorizes him as an adult, he’s still got plenty of puppy left in both attitude and energy. He clearly has German Shepherd roots, though what else is mixed in isn’t certain. Asher’s essentially a big, playful goof—he adores being chased by people and other dogs and gravitates toward activity and engagement at every turn. He does well in the car, is house-trained, and knows crate life comfortably. His personality skews submissive: he isn’t aggressive, and he tends to be welcoming with strangers. Asher spent time growing up with small children but, due to his boundless energy and size, a home with little kids isn’t the best fit unless someone’s committed to helping him learn not to accidentally knock them over. He thrives in open spaces: fenced yards, dog parks, and days filled with play suit him perfectly, while apartments or townhomes absolutely don’t. He gets on well with other dogs and really needs a playful dog companion. German Shepherd mixes like Asher crave leadership, structure, and daily mental and physical challenges. He’s perceptive, quick to learn, eager to please, and especially motivated by food rewards. Someone dedicated to positive training and an active routine is the right match.
